Product Description
ZHL-20W-13SW+ is a Class-A, high dynamic range, unconditionally stable amplifier with automatic over temperature and over voltage protectionꢀ
It features a built-in RF switch with TTL/CMOS controlꢀ

▲ Heat sink and fan not includedꢀ Alternative heat sinking and heat removal must be provided by
the user to limit maximum base-plate temperature to 85°C, in order to ensure proper performanceꢀ
For reference, this requires thermal resistance of user’s external heat sink to be 0ꢀ3°C/W maxꢀ
